Résumé
"The child is dead. There is nothing left to know...". Tracker is a hunter, known in the thirteen kingdoms as one who has a nose - and he always works alone. But he breaks this rule when he joins a band seeking a lost child. His companions are strange and dangerous, from a giant to a witch to a shape-shifting Leopard, and each hides their own secrets. As they follow the boy's scent, from perfumed citadels to infested rivers to enchanted darklands, set upon by murderous foes, Tracker wonders : who is this mysterious boy ? Why don't people want him found ? And, crucially, who is telling the truth and who is lying ?
